備份命令注解
mongodump -h 127.0.0.1:27017 -u sa -p sa123 -d CCMDB -o D:\temp
-h 服務器IP、端口號
-u 訪問用戶名
-p 密碼
-d 數據庫實例
-o 備份路徑
恢復命令
mongorestore -h 127.0.0.1:27017 -u sa -p sa123 -d CCMDB D:\temp\CCMDB --drop
創建用戶
db.createUser({user:'sa',pwd:'sa123',roles:[{role:'dbOwner',db:'CCMDBOperation'},{role:'readWrite',db:'CCMDBOperation'}]})
批量更新
db.getCollection('UserInfo').update({ "Sex" : '女' } , { $set : {"Password" : '96-5E-B7-2C-92-A5-49-DD' } },false,true)
備份單個表
mongodump -h 192.168.64.222:27017 -u sa -p sa123 -d CCMDBForTest -c SystemSetup -o ~/desktop/mongoBackup/
恢復單個表
mongorestore -h 192.168.64.222:27017 -u sa -p sa123 -d CCMDB -c SystemSetup ~/desktop/mongoBackup/CCMDB/SystemSetup.bson